Iggy Azalea makes notable social gains on Billboard’s charts after her appearance on NBC’s Saturday Night Live (Oct. 25), on which she debuted two new songs: “Beg for It” (featuring ) and “Iggy SZN.” Both are set to be on her album Reclassified (due Nov. 24), and both tracks hit the realtime Billboard + Twitter Trending 140 chart within an hour after their performances, and both debut on the weekly Billboard + Twitter Top Tracks chart from the cumulative amount of shares they received; “Iggy SZN” bows at No. 37 and “Beg for It,” No. 41.

The performances also cause Azalea to experience a 4 percent gain in overall points on the Social 50 (which ranks the top artists across major social platforms), where she rises 14-13. For the week, she added 170,000 fans across Twitter and Facebook and experienced a 73 percent rise in weekly reactions on Instagram (according to Next Big Sound), where she posted scenes from the broadcast.

“Iggy SZN” is a reference to TopSZN, Drake‘s brand, marked by a hand gesture with which followers of Drake on Instagram are readily familiar. Drake makes his own headlines, jumping 12-7 on the Social 50 with a 44 percent rise in points after debuting three new tracks on Oct. 25 through SoundCloud. The most popular of the bunch, “How About Now,” produced by Boi-1da and Jordan Evans, debuts at No. 8 on the weekly Top Tracks chart, making it his third release to debut in the chart’s top 10.

Other notable debuts on the weekly Billboard + Twitter Top Tracks chart include Taylor Swift‘s “Welcome to New York,” which picked up a sizable amount of online buzz after her album 1989 leaked on Oct. 24.

Fans of Katy Perry drive her “Birthday” track back onto the list at No. 21, after they tweeted the track on Oct. 25 in celebration of Perry’s own actual birthday that day.

As for the Social 50 leaderboard, Selena Gomez bounds 6-1 to reach the top position on the Social 50 for the second time after a slew of Instagram posts prompts a 174 percent in weekly reactions on the platform. Swift marches 3-2, while Justin Bieber tumbles (1-3) along with Miley Cyrus (2-4). Demi Lovato climbs 8-5 along with One Direction (7-6). Snoop Dogg slides 5-8 while birthday girl Perry climbs 10-9, and Beyonce moves 9-10 to anchor.
